Notes: Get 96c of water at 161 degrees and mash for 90 minutes (Mash temp 151). Drain wort. Add 30c of water at 175 degrees for sparge/mash-out. Drain wort. 90-minute boil adding bittering hops straight away. At 10min, add flavor hops/Irish moss. Cool to under 60 degrees. Pitch White Labs WLP830 German Lager yeast
Lagering: Ferment at 49 degrees for 1-2 weeks. Syphon into secondary container. Begin lagering at 50 degrees and steadily increase temperature to 65 (cellar temp) over 2-3weeks. After that, bring beer to 65-70 degrees for 3 days (diacetyl rest). Transfer to keg and age at 34-35 degrees for another few weeks.

Notes: The original recipe calls for an equal amount of barley and flaked oats as well as London Fog yeast. With the Hothead yeast I have on hand, the estimated abv shot up into the upper 7% range, which is a bit higher than I was wanting because I'm afraid of the alcohol flavor coming through over the hops. So, I reduced the amount of flaked oats to an even 1# to drop the abv into the mid 6% range to hopefully achieve balance. This being a 1 gallon recipe, it's easy to play around with and not worry about having 5 gallons or more of a beer you are unsatisfied with. If using extract in place of the grains, this will be a 30 minute brew since the LME/DME is already boiled and sanitized from the malters, it just needs dissolved completely. |

Notes: Orange peel, heather and honey are added at the post-boil whirlpool. Temp/time is high enough to ensure pasteurization while maintaining aromatics. This version has made a few changes from a previous brewing. Heather tips are reserved for the whirlpool as they are intended primarily as an aroma contributor instead of for bittering in the boil. The malt balance is shifted to a slightly drier finish by using honey. A Belgian yeast is going to be purely experimental instead of the WLP001 I used the first time around. This will be a split batch with one getting the regular Cali Ale yeast to see how the two differ. |
